| Feature | Details |
|---|---|
| Model | Vitamix Ascent Series A3500 |
| Container Size | 64-ounce Low-Profile Container |
| Control Interface | Touchscreen with Variable Speed Control & Pulse |
| Program Settings | 5 Program Settings (Smoothies, Hot Soups, Dips & Spreads, Frozen Desserts, Self-Cleaning) |
| Connectivity | Bluetooth with Vitamix Perfect Blend App |
| Motor | Peak 2.2-horsepower motor |
| Blade Material | Laser-cut, stainless-steel hammermill and cutting blades |
| Warranty | 10-Year Full Warranty |

For daily smoothie prep, the preset ‘smoothie’ program handled frozen fruit, ice, and leafy greens with impressive ease, consistently delivering a velvety texture without ever feeling like it was straining. And the noise? A robust hum, not a piercing shriek. On weekends, when we tackled hot soups, the Vitamix A3500 heated ingredients through friction, creating steaming hot, perfectly smooth purees. Even grinding nuts for homemade almond butter, a task that often pushes blenders to their loudest limits, was remarkably less offensive than expected. It’s interesting to note that the sound profile felt more ‘deep rumble’ and less ‘high-pitched whine’, which makes a huge difference in perceived loudness.

The touchscreen controls are intuitive, and the five program settings take the guesswork out of common tasks. We especially appreciated the self-cleaning function – a drop of soap and warm water, and it’s spotless in 60 seconds. The Bluetooth connectivity and Perfect Blend App are neat additions, offering even more pre-sets and recipes, though we mostly stuck to the on-device programs. The smart container detection is also clever, adjusting blend times based on the container size, ensuring consistency whether you’re making a single serving or a family batch.

Vitamix Ascent A3500 vs. The Competition
When considering the A3500, it’s natural to compare it to other top blenders. While it clearly stands out for its quieter operation at high performance, competitors like the Blendtec Designer 725 offer similar power and smart features, often with a slightly different interface (tactile sliders vs. touchscreen). For those on a tighter budget, the Vitamix E310 Explorian delivers classic Vitamix power and durability at a more accessible price point, though it lacks the advanced smart features and isn’t quite as optimized for noise reduction. Ultimately, the A3500 carves out its niche by combining uncompromised power with a genuinely more pleasant user experience from a sound perspective.
